How to check an image's dpi (ppi)/resolution in a pdf in Foxit PDF Editor
Actually PDF files do not have a single "DPI" value. Each bitmap object has a separate resolution, and of course vector objects such as text have no resolution at all.

How to check the page size of a PDF in Foxit PDF Editor/Reader?
There are two methods to check the PDF page size in Foxit PDF Editor/Reader:First Method:1: Open the PDF document with Foxit PDF Editor/Reader.2: Click on the "File" tab in the menu bar at the top.3: In the drop-down menu, select "Properties" and then "Description".4: Under the "Description" section, you will find the 'Page Size' of the current page.
